About the role

  • Execute consultant relations strategy and build partnerships with top consulting and brokerage firms to drive referrals for Lantern’s surgery, cancer, and infusion products.
  • Educate consultants and brokers on Lantern’s value proposition and differentiators and develop tailored content in partnership with marketing and sales enablement.
  • Gather insight and feedback from consultant partners to continuously refine messaging and support.
  • Partner closely with Sales, Solutions Consulting, and Client Success on consultant-led client growth, deal strategy, and expansion opportunities.
  • Build relationships at both national and regional levels to influence and educate consultant intellectual capital.
  • Stay close to active deals when appropriate, leveraging consultant/broker relationships to influence decision factors.
  • Identify opportunities for improvement within and outside the consulting relations mandate and recommend how to address them.
  • Establish strong cross-functional relationships with analytics, clinical, marketing, network, member services, and related functions to ensure a “one team” approach.
  • Drive top-of-funnel growth (employee lives added via consultants/brokers), overall net ACV revenue growth, win rate, education penetration, and engagement on qualified opportunities.
  • Role is remote (USA) with travel required.

Requirements

  • 15-20 years of professional experience working with employer health care benefits, in both health and benefits consulting and in a client- or consultant-facing role within a health care solution/vendor.
  • Deep relationships and credibility across 1 or more of the top consulting/brokerage firms.
  • Ability to influence client and consultant points of view and decisions with a thoughtful, data driven perspective, supported by real-life experience.
  • Experience in consultative sales or business development.
  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to confidently convey complex information and messages to a broad and diverse audience, both internal and external.
  • Clear understanding of the mechanics of self-funded medical plans and the relationships between health plans/third party administrators, health care providers, and plan sponsors.
  • Effective interpersonal skills with the ability to work independently and within a team environment, both externally facing and behind the scenes.
  • Comfortable working in a high-growth, fast-changing environment; organized, adaptable, diligent, and self-motivated.
  • Passion for Lantern’s mission and collaborating with others.
  • Bachelor’s degree required.
  • Preferred: Strong analytical skills, including experience working with medical claims data to project savings/program impact.
  • Preferred: Knowledge of broader ecosystem of point solutions and health care disruptors selling to self-funded employers.
  • Preferred: Ability to adopt continuous improvement mindset and actively contribute to the processes and procedures of the larger Commercial team.
  • Preferred: Experience in an early / growth stage business.
